Artificial insemination, also known as intrauterine insemination (IUI), is a fertility treatment that involves placing sperm directly into a woman’s uterus. This method of conception has been around for centuries, with the earliest recorded case dating back to the 18th century. However, it wasn’t until the 20th century that artificial insemination began to be used as a treatment for infertility.
The process of artificial insemination begins with the collection of sperm from the male partner or a sperm donor. The sperm is then washed and prepared, ensuring that only the healthiest and most motile sperm are used for the procedure. Next, the sperm is placed into the woman’s uterus using a thin catheter, which is inserted through the cervix. This process is usually painless and takes only a few minutes to complete.
One of the most significant advantages of artificial insemination is that it is a relatively simple and non-invasive procedure. Unlike other fertility treatments, such as in vitro fertilization (IVF), artificial insemination does not require the use of hormones or invasive procedures. This makes it a more accessible and less expensive option for couples struggling with infertility.
So, how does artificial insemination work to help couples conceive? There are several ways in which this procedure can increase a couple’s chances of getting pregnant. First, it places the sperm directly into the uterus, bypassing any potential barriers that may be hindering conception. Additionally, the sperm is prepared and concentrated, increasing the number of sperm that reach the egg, thus improving the chances of fertilization.
Artificial insemination can also be used in conjunction with fertility drugs, such as clomiphene citrate, to stimulate ovulation. This can be particularly helpful for couples who are struggling with ovulation issues. By combining artificial insemination with fertility drugs, the chances of conception are further increased.

One of the most significant benefits of artificial insemination is that it can be used for a variety of fertility issues, making it a versatile treatment option. It can help couples with male factor infertility, such as low sperm count or poor sperm motility. It can also be used for women with cervical issues, such as hostile cervical mucus, which can make it difficult for sperm to reach the egg.
Artificial insemination is also a popular option for same-sex female couples and single women who want to have a child. In these cases, donor sperm is used for the insemination process, allowing these women to fulfill their dreams of becoming mothers.
While artificial insemination has a high success rate, it is not a guarantee of pregnancy. Factors such as the age of the woman, the quality of sperm, and any underlying fertility issues can impact the success of the procedure. However, many couples have successfully conceived through artificial insemination, and it continues to be a popular option for those struggling with infertility.
In addition to artificial insemination, science has also made significant advancements in the field of assisted reproductive technology (ART). ART includes procedures such as in vitro fertilization (IVF), where eggs and sperm are fertilized in a laboratory and then implanted into the uterus. Other techniques, such as intracytoplasmic sperm injection (ICSI), involve injecting a single sperm directly into an egg to increase the chances of fertilization.
